SPLIT RAIL – Dual Axis Snowmobile Skis

October 9, 2010 1 comment

Split Rail, Dual Axis, Snowmobile SkiUnveiled to the public at haydays on Sept 11, 2010 in North Branch MN, the split rail ski is new to the snowmobile market this year. With the Split Rail Ski being marketed at many of this falls major snowmobile and power sports expo’s by two sons of the inventor and recently featured in the March 2011 SuperTrax Magazine this ski is sure to have the guys talking in the shop, bragging on the trail and gloating around the dinner table; that is if you can get your hands on a set.  Three years of testing have gone into these skis and they claim they will hold up to the abuse that hardcore sledders tend to put their sleds through.

What the Media has to say.Split Rail, Dual Axis, Snowmobile Ski

In a letter to Rob Wrightman, the president of the Split Rail Ski Mark Lester, the Publisher of Supertrax International Magazine wrote: “To say [the ski] is unique is a huge understatement. Based on looks alone the ski is literally dripping with appeal and bonafide sizzle.”, “you’ve got something here which will improve and further both handling and control on most modern snowmobiles.” and “It’s got great potential to re-write the rules and carve out a new identity for itself in the snowmobile industry.”

What do I think

With an emphatic thumbs up from the president of Snowtrax Magazine and the Split Rail Ski claims to “eliminate darting” with the catch phrase “‘It’s like Riding on Rails ‘ No longer just a Figure of Speech… … It’s a Reality” it’s difficult not to buy into the promise of a better handling ride however, the near $800 price tag may be a bit limiting to the masses though. I would love to get a set of these on my sled for a season and tell you hands down you’ve got to get a pair. But, unfortunately for Split Rail Ski my sled is only a year old so I don’t have a need for a new set of skis. If for some reason I damaged a ski however I would definitely be replacing it with the Split Rail Ski. My guess is the manufacturing costs are comparable to existing skis and, I wouldn’t be surprised if one of the big four snowmobile manufacturers would be interested in purchasing either the patent or manufacturing rights. Maybe we’ll see these or something similar on future factory production sleds. The Split Rail Ski is eye candy for your snowmobile that not only looks good but claims to perform as good as they look.
